The distance between Marseille and Malaga is 1107km (686 miles). The average flight duration is 2h 5m. There are 12 direct flights from Marseille to Malaga. Marseille and Malaga are in the same time zone. Flights from Marseille begin at 6:25 AM. The latest flight from Marseille departs at 10:45 PM

Marseille Provence Airport (MRS) is the city’s main international gateway and typically serves a mix of legacy carriers, low-cost airlines and seasonal charter services, making it a practical option for both business and leisure travelers. Located about 25 km northwest of Marseille’s city center, travel times are usually around 25–35 minutes by car depending on traffic; shuttle buses to Saint-Charles station take roughly 25–30 minutes and cost in the range of modest fares, while taxis and rideshares can be quicker but more expensive. The airport offers car rental desks and limited public bus connections; pros include straightforward layouts and regular flight choices, while cons can be occasional congestion and longer transfers to the urban core compared with closer urban airports.

Málaga–Costa del Sol Airport (AGP) is the region’s main international gateway, handling a mix of legacy and low-cost carriers and commonly serving holiday and business traffic. Located about 8 km southwest of Málaga city centre, it’s usually reachable in 15–25 minutes by taxi or 20–30 minutes by the C1 Cercanías train, with fares typically modest for public transport and higher for taxis. Regular bus services connect central plazas and the coast in roughly 30–40 minutes at low cost, while car hire is widely available on site. Pros: direct international links and quick rail access; cons: can be busy in summer and some facilities are geared toward short-stay leisure travellers.
